Output ab4048fafba23f716ae6959ca85a41facd2c4b1b3f75267715d4b38671e5a629:0

value
2704900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8352b64e4f7ace7254aa73707223081b4ff0179f OP_EQUAL
address
3DfPXcXE7vKu7wqewtYcb26R85Wzhk59r3
transaction
ab4048fafba23f716ae6959ca85a41facd2c4b1b3f75267715d4b38671e5a629